如何使用 ibm maximo 中的自动化脚本创建禁用事件侦听器的出站接口

问题描述 投票:0回答:1

是否有可能使用自动化脚本来生成出站负载,即使来自发布通道的事件侦听器被禁用?

我正在尝试创建一个自动化脚本,可以从发布通道生成禁用事件侦听器的有效负载,但我不知道如何执行此操作。

maximo
1个回答
0
投票

可以手动触发发布通道。这是一些参考资料。但是:我尝试设置一次但不成功,我确实保存了代码并添加了注释“顺便说一句,在上面的行中出现了越界错误”

from psdi.server import MXServer 
from psdi.security import UserInfo  
from psdi.util.logging import MXLogger 
from psdi.util.logging import MXLoggerFactory  
from psdi.mbo import MboConstants

server = MXServer.getMXServer()
userInfo = server.getUserInfo("MAXADMIN")
whereClause = "PMNUM = 'PM108688'"
server.lookup("MIC").exportData("<publish channel>", "<External System Name>", whereClause, userInfo, 1)

也就是说,很少有不同的参考资料表明它可以工作 - 下面的第二个参考资料在评论中表明他可以工作,只是不适用于 JSON 输出。

之前的 stackoverflow 问题

maxdeploy 博客文章

© www.soinside.com 2019 - 2024. All rights reserved.